Viral diseases

Viral plant diseases are conditions caused by phytoviruses, which are submicroscopic infectious agents consisting of genetic material (DNA or RNA) enclosed in a protein coat. Being obligate intracellular parasites, they must enter a host cell to replicate, where they disrupt normal metabolic pathways, leading to systemic physiological stress in the plant organism.

Viral diseases

These diseases affect a diverse range of botanical families, posing significant threats to cereals, vegetables, legumes, and perennial fruit crops. Major economically significant infections include potato mosaic virus, cucumber mosaic virus, and tomato spotted wilt virus, which can compromise agricultural productivity globally across various climate zones.

The primary clinical manifestations of viral infections include chlorosis, leaf mosaic patterns, vein clearing, and necrotic spots. Affected plants often exhibit morphological abnormalities such as leaf curling, stunting, reduced fruit set, and abnormal seed development. These systemic signs are indicative of viral spread through the phloem, affecting the overall vigor and growth of the plant.

Viral transmission is highly efficient through biological vectors—most notably insects like aphids, whiteflies, thrips, and mites—that acquire the virus from infected tissues and transmit it to healthy ones. Additionally, viruses spread mechanically through farm machinery, pruning tools, and grafting, or via infected propagation materials like tubers, cuttings, or seeds, which harbor the pathogen in a dormant state.

The damage caused by plant viruses is often irreparable since there are no curative chemical treatments; therefore, disease control relies entirely on preventive measures. Key strategies for sustainable management include:

  • sourcing certified, virus-free seeds and planting stock;
  • implementing rigorous vector control programs to manage insect populations;
  • removing and destroying weed hosts that serve as virus reservoirs;
  • adhering to strict sanitation protocols for pruning and cultivation equipment;
  • breeding and cultivating genetically resistant varieties of major crops.
